Output 50670b38476ffbb71cf35f433de73aad036e26ec6868692579aeaf5fbac0c272:43

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cead2a15a97e03ff1370c2a73c67a782e8d5ee04a6f2b12ea5329d4a1accdc49
address
tb1pe6kj59df0cpl7ymsc2nncea8st5dtmsy5metzt49x2w55xkvm3ysafz0we
transaction
50670b38476ffbb71cf35f433de73aad036e26ec6868692579aeaf5fbac0c272
spent
true